深入了解反向代理如何助力HTTPS加密协议,保障数据传输的安全性
一、引言
随着互联网技术的飞速发展,网络安全问题日益受到关注。
为了保护用户数据的安全传输,许多企业和组织采用HTTPS加密协议。
为了提高安全性和性能,仅仅依赖HTTPS可能还不足以应对日益增长的网络攻击和威胁。
本文将深入探讨反向代理在助力HTTPS加密协议中的重要作用,以确保数据传输的安全性。
二、HTTPS加密协议概述
HTTPS是一种通过SSL/TLS协议对HTTP进行加密的通信协议。
在HTTPS通信过程中,数据在客户端和服务器之间传输前会进行加密处理,从而确保数据在传输过程中的安全性。
随着网络安全威胁的不断升级,攻击者可能会采用各种手段绕过HTTPS加密,窃取用户数据。
因此,我们需要借助其他技术手段来增强HTTPS的安全性。
三、反向代理概念及作用
反向代理是指服务器与客户端之间的代理服务器。
它位于内部网络,处理来自客户端的请求并转发到目标服务器。
反向代理的主要作用包括负载均衡、缓存优化和安全防护等。
在助力HTTPS加密协议方面,反向代理发挥着重要作用。
四、反向代理如何助力HTTPS加密协议
1. 增强加密强度:通过反向代理服务器,可以实施更强大的加密策略。例如,使用更高级别的SSL/TLS证书和加密算法,提高数据传输的加密强度,有效抵御攻击者的破解尝试。
2. 中间层安全防护:反向代理服务器作为中间层,可以过滤和检测来自客户端的请求。通过配置规则,可以阻止恶意请求和攻击,从而保护目标服务器免受攻击。例如,通过阻断常见的网络攻击,如跨站脚本攻击(XSS)和SQL注入攻击等。
3. 负载均衡与性能优化:反向代理服务器可以分散目标服务器的负载,提高网站的响应速度和性能。在HTTPS通信中,由于加密和解密过程需要消耗计算资源,反向代理可以通过分担这部分负担,提高整体系统的性能和安全性。
4. 数据压缩与传输优化:反向代理服务器可以对数据进行压缩和优化,减少数据传输量。这不仅可以提高数据传输速度,还可以降低带宽成本。在HTTPS通信中,通过压缩优化后的数据传输,可以进一步提高通信的安全性。
5. 灵活的访问控制:反向代理服务器可以实现灵活的访问控制策略。例如,根据IP地址、时间段等因素限制访问,确保只有合法的用户才能访问目标服务器。这可以有效防止未经授权的访问和攻击。
6. HTTPS重定向管理:通过反向代理服务器,可以方便地管理HTTPS重定向。当客户端尝试通过HTTP访问网站时,反向代理服务器可以将请求重定向到HTTPS,确保用户通过加密的通信方式访问网站。
五、结合实例分析反向代理在HTTPS中的应用
以某大型电商平台为例,该平台采用HTTPS加密协议保护用户数据的安全传输。
为了进一步提高安全性和性能,该平台部署了反向代理服务器。
通过实施更强大的加密策略、中间层安全防护、负载均衡与性能优化等措施,该平台有效提高了数据传输的安全性、响应速度和性能。
在实际运行中,反向代理服务器还帮助该平台进行流量分析和数据统计,为优化网站性能和用户体验提供了有力支持。
六、结论
反向代理在助力HTTPS加密协议中发挥着重要作用。
通过增强加密强度、中间层安全防护、负载均衡与性能优化等措施,反向代理可以有效提高数据传输的安全性和性能。
在实际应用中,结合具体的业务需求和场景,反向代理还可以实现更多功能,为网络安全和性能优化提供有力支持。
评论一下吧
取消回复